Essential Maintenance Tips to Prolong the Lifespan of Your 4JA1 Engine
To preserve the durability of the Isuzu 4JA1 engine, routine upkeep is essential. Regular oil replacements using high-quality oil maintain internal components lubricated and reduce wear. Checking and swapping the air filter regularly ensures optimal air circulation, improving engine efficiency. Moreover, tracking coolant amounts and inspecting the cooling system prevent overheating, a common issue for diesel engines.
Periodically inspecting hose and belt systems for evidence of wear can prevent breakdowns. Keeping the fuel injection system clean by using high-quality fuel and periodic fuel filter changes promotes optimal combustion. Additionally, maintaining proper tire pressure and alignment not only improves fuel economy but also reduces strain on the engine.
To summarize, adhering to the maker's recommended maintenance schedules ensures that all components work efficiently. By implementing these maintenance tips, vehicle owners can substantially prolong the life of their Isuzu 4JA1 engine, ensuring steady operation over the extended timeframe.
Diagnosing Typical Difficulties With the 4JA1 Engine
Consistent upkeep can help in averting many complications associated with the Isuzu 4JA1 engine, though issues may still occur over time. Overheating is a common issue, often caused by a faulty thermostat or a review article blocked radiator. It is recommended that drivers regularly assess coolant levels and inspect for leaks in the cooling system. Poor fuel efficiency is another common problem, which can be due to clogged fuel filters or defective injectors. Keeping these components clean can enhance performance. Furthermore, odd noises may indicate worn bearings or timing belt issues; early diagnosis is vital to stop extensive damage. Finally, smoke from the exhaust might signal combustion problems, possibly from worn piston rings or valve seals. Addressing these issues promptly and seeking advice from a qualified mechanic can increase the longevity and reliability of the 4JA1 engine, ensuring it continues to perform optimally.
